MORPHOLOGICAL CHANGES IN THE THYMUS AND SPLEEN IN RENAL FAILURE
IN RATS AND CORRECTION WITH POMEGRANATE SEED OIL
Khamdamova M.T., Teshaev Sh.Zh., Khikmatova M.F.
Bukhara State Medical Institute named after Abu Ali ibn Sina, Uzbekistan, Bukhara,
Gijduvan str., 23. Tel: +998(65) 223-00-50 e-mail:
buhme@mail.ru
Resume
Laboratory rats were exposed to salt water, which is known to be toxic to the kidneys. After
confirming the development of kidney failure in rats, a study was conducted on the effectiveness of
pomegranate seed oil, which was provided to them as a dietary supplement over a certain period of
time. Rats exposed to salt water showed signs of kidney failure, such as increased creatinine and urea
levels in the blood, as well as changes in the morphology of kidney tissue. When adding pomegranate
seed oil to the diet of rats, an improvement in kidney function was observed, which was confirmed by
a decrease in the biochemical parameters of creatinine and urea in the blood, as well as an
improvement in the histological characteristics of the kidney tissue. Pomegranate seed oil shows
potential in correcting salt water-induced renal failure in rats under experimental conditions. These
results may indicate the possibility of using pomegranate seed oil as a potential therapeutic agent for
the treatment or prevention of kidney diseases in humans.
